Transforming a broken PBI report in the slow lane to cruising in the fast lane

"The pbix file is slow to import the data. Most of the visuals are not rendering in the report" - how do we fix this report?

This session is based on a real-life use case of re-developing a multi-page Power BI report from "slow and unusable" into a single page report that was " fast and nimble".

In this session we will walk through the process of transforming this report from changing how data was being imported in Power Query, to a revised semantic model and then making use of Field Parameters in the re-designed report page. Along the way we will cover 'best practices' and how implementing these "best practices" enabled the client to use the report with ease and in the process reduced the size of the pbix file by over 90%.

By the end of this session, you'll be equipped with practical techniques to enhance the performance and design of your Power BI reports.

This session is ideal for Power BI users, data analysts, and business intelligence professionals who want to improve the performance and efficiency of their Power BI reports
